A Journey Through Fitness and Mental Health

Stephanie Buttermore, who passed away just days after her 36th birthday, was not only a former bodybuilder but also a beacon of hope and empowerment for many. Her fiancé, Jeff Nippard, shared the heartbreaking news and reflected on her compassion and dedication to her family and research in ovarian cancer.

Having earned a PhD in Biomedical Sciences, Buttermore utilized her extensive knowledge to create a substantial online presence, amassing over 525,000 followers on Instagram and nearly 1.2 million subscribers on YouTube. She focused on sharing workout routines, nutritional guidance, and wellness tips aimed at helping women navigate their fitness journeys.

Stepping Back for Mental Wellness

Rather than letting the pressures of social media define her, Buttermore recognized the need to prioritize her mental health. In 2024, she took a break from all social media, marking this crucial transition with a candid update about her well-being. She reported significant improvements in her mental state, stating she was no longer battling crippling anxiety that had once limited her daily life.

Her honesty resonated deeply with her audience, who admired her courage in stepping back from the spotlight to prioritize her mental health. By openly addressing her struggles, she became an inspiration to countless followers, demonstrating that seeking help and taking a step back can lead to a healthier and more balanced life.

Practical Tips for Mental and Physical Fitness

While we celebrate Stephanie Buttermore’s life and contributions, her legacy serves as a cautionary tale about the importance of mental health in our fitness journeys. Here are some practical tips to maintain balance in both:

  1. Listen to Your Body: Recognize signs of fatigue and mental strain. Rest and recovery are just as important as workouts.

  2. Take Breaks: Don’t hesitate to step back from social media or your usual routine if it feels overwhelming. Prioritizing mental health is crucial.

  3. Seek Support: Whether through friends, family, or professionals, speaking about your struggles can provide relief and perspective.

  4. Stay Active: Regular physical activity can be beneficial for mental health, helping to reduce anxiety and improve mood. Find a routine you enjoy and stick to it.

  5. Mindful Nutrition: Instead of focusing solely on diets, aim for balanced nutrition that fuels both your body and mind.

  6. Practice Self-Compassion: Understand that everyone has challenges, and it’s okay to seek support. Forgive yourself for setbacks and focus on progress, not perfection.
